Review
For a bmw, the X1 is quite slow. In my opinion the car have rather slow acceleration and the car boot is not big enough for say 2 golf bags. You do however get many side pocket to store all the stuff. However the car feels very good at singapore speed. It rides comfortably on the expressway and the sunroof is a bonus. The rear legroom seem rather cramp as well.

What I like
-The sunroof

-Petrol consumption(on one tank i get like 700km)

-The standard features on the car

-Good handling

What I do not like
-Small boot space

-Space at the rear is quite small

-slow acceleration

-Car is Rear drive and not all wheel drive

Review
The car is pretty good provided is has been well optioned.
Actually got my x1 for about 2 months.

On paper, the power output made the car seem very slow and underpowered but after the break in period, i feel the car is adequate for Singapore roads. Acceleration is really nothing to rave about, but i find the car pretty stable at high speeds and cornering is good. The cabin is pretty quiet pass 100km/h.
Stock sound system is also not too shabby.
The car is essentially a 3 series but in a SUV body. But as it is not as high as regular SUVs the car is still quite like a sedan. The size of the car is very similar to that of a Honda Civic but taller. To be honest, if you are getting this as a family ride you are better off with a Honda Civic as the Honda Civic is more generous with the rear passenger space and the boot!

* had the car for 2 months so i cant rate reliability.

What I like
I hate to say but it's a BMW.
I know many people think we are stupid for paying the premium just for the brand. But when you drive it, it really is something different.
It may not have the same power as the Tiguan but it is more refined ride compared to the Tiguan. If you want "power" push the gear into sport mode. You don't get any "faster" but the car does feels sportier with the increased throttle response and the delayed gear change.
Standard options include:
Leather, panoramic sunroof, electric memory seats, auto sensing HID Lights, auto sensing rain wipers, front and rear PDC. (these are not standard is other countries and once you are used to cars with these options, it's quite hard to go back to basic cars.)

What I do not like
My petrol consumption is 11.5L/100km but this is 60% city and 40% highway.
Crazy high price in SG.
Car is only rear-wheel drive. No 4 wheel drive option in Singapore.

Other than that, there's really nothing I don't like about it. Just wished I could retrofit front PDC and Bi-xenon headlights
